bump the version
[dmaap/messagerouter/msgrtr.git] / src / test / java / org / onap / dmaap / mr / cambria / backends / memory / MessageLoggerTest.java
1 /*-
2  * ============LICENSE_START=======================================================
3  * ONAP Policy Engine
4  * ================================================================================
5  * Copyright (C) 2017 AT&T Intellectual Property. All rights reserved.
6  * ================================================================================
7  * Licensed under the Apache License, Version 2.0 (the "License");
8  * you may not use this file except in compliance with the License.
9  * You may obtain a copy of the License at
10  * 
11  *      http://www.apache.org/licenses/LICENSE-2.0
12  * 
13  * Unless required by applicable law or agreed to in writing, software
14  * distributed under the License is distributed on an "AS IS" BASIS,
15  *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
16  * See the License for the specific language governing permissions and
17  * limitations under the License.
18  * ============LICENSE_END=========================================================
19  */
20
21  package org.onap.dmaap.mr.cambria.backends.memory;
22
23 import static org.junit.Assert.*;
24
25 import java.io.IOException;
26
27 import org.junit.After;
28 import org.junit.Before;
29 import org.junit.Test;
30
31 import org.onap.dmaap.dmf.mr.backends.memory.MessageLogger;
32
33
34 public class MessageLoggerTest {
35
36         @Before
37         public void setUp() throws Exception {
38         }
39
40         @After
41         public void tearDown() throws Exception {
42         }
43
44         @Test
45         public void testSendMessage() {
46                 MessageLogger dropper = new MessageLogger();
47                 
48                 try {
49                         dropper.sendMessage("testTopic", null);
50                 } catch (IOException e) {
51                         // TODO Auto-generated catch block
52                         e.printStackTrace();
53                 } catch (NullPointerException e) {
54                         // TODO Auto-generated catch block
55                         assertTrue(true);
56                 }
57                 
58                 String trueValue = "True";
59                 assertTrue(trueValue.equalsIgnoreCase("True"));
60                 
61         }
62         
63         @Test
64         public void testSendMessages() {
65                 MessageLogger dropper = new MessageLogger();
66                  
67                 try {
68                         dropper.sendMessages("testTopic", null);
69                 } catch (IOException e) {
70                         // TODO Auto-generated catch block
71                         e.printStackTrace();
72                 } catch (NullPointerException e) {
73                         // TODO Auto-generated catch block
74                         assertTrue(true);
75                 }
76                 
77                 String trueValue = "True";
78                 assertTrue(trueValue.equalsIgnoreCase("True"));
79                 
80         }
81         
82         @Test
83         public void testSendBatchMessage() {
84                 MessageLogger dropper = new MessageLogger();
85                 
86                 try {
87                         dropper.sendBatchMessageNew("testTopic", null);
88                 } catch (IOException e) {
89                         // TODO Auto-generated catch block
90                         e.printStackTrace();
91                 }
92                 
93                 String trueValue = "True";
94                 assertTrue(trueValue.equalsIgnoreCase("True"));
95                 
96         }
97         
98         
99
100 }
101
102
103
104